Output 51a0a3139b16b857e8bbfb314fa9d2631d77f362451dbd80eb73ea458ef954a1:1

value
3074381643
script pubkey
OP_0 OP_PUSHBYTES_20 6df5d59455ce29c259cc1608327fd339a9386975
address
ltc1qdh6at9z4ec5uykwvzcyryl7n8x5ns6t4cnlvz7
transaction
51a0a3139b16b857e8bbfb314fa9d2631d77f362451dbd80eb73ea458ef954a1
spent
true